YOUNGSTOWN - The Youngstown Fire Department was called out to a house fire near the intersection of Breaden St. & Hillman St. on the City's Southside.

Crews were called to the scene around 9:45 Thursday for reports of a structure fire. Crews on the scene reported a two-story wooden structure with fire showing.

A short time later, additional crews were called to the scene.

As of 10:05 Thursday night, Youngstown Fire Dispatch told 21 News that YFD had 7 crews responding.

A 21 News crew sent to the area reported that the fire was out as of around 10:15 p.m.

It is currently unclear whether the home was occupied or what caused the fire. Dispatchers told firefighters that Dominion had turned off gas service to the property in 2019. 

The incident remains under investigation.
